My guess is that he still loves you, but he's crushed. If you fell in love with someone and they said "Yeah, I love you too but I'd really like to sleep with someone else first and you can be there as my backup plan", how would you feel? I don't imagine that you would feel all that great about it and, considering that's how he's going to take it, he probably doesn't feel all that good about it either. You two need to sit down and really decide if you love each other or not. If you do, then school/financial difficulties won't stop you. People who really love each other don't let anything stand in their way when it comes to having a truly meaningful relationship. Good luck, I hope it all goes well.
